  • In this Providence Spokane heart surgery video, learn what to expect after having open heart surgery. Providence hospital patients learn what to expect after having open heart surgery in Spokane at Providence Sacred Heart Medical Center & Children's Hospital, and what it will be like as you recover at home from heart surgery.
    We encourage you to ask you doctor if you have any questions about your surgery, recovery, or anything you see in this video.
